DRIVE BELT REMOVAL AND REPLACEMENT (Model 380 Series)

If you need to replace a worn or broken drive belt, follow steps 1 through 30.

Step 1. Disconnect the spark plug and ground it.

Step 2. Drain the fuel tank.

Step 3. Remove rear hub caps and wheels.

Step 4. Remove eight phillips head screws.

Step 5. Tip mower back on its handle and block securely.

Step 6. Remove blade and blade adapter.

Step 7. Remove three hex head screws holding small baffle.

Step 8. Remove small baffle.

Step 9. Remove large baffle.

Step 10. Loosen hex lock nut holding idler bearing.

Step 11. Using a pair of pliers, pull back and rotate belt keeper bracket from the slot on idler pulley.

Step 12. Slide the belt out from between the Belt Keeper Bracket and the idler pulley.
